How to Style a Bookshelf to Look Effortlessly Chic

A well-styled bookshelf can serve as both a functional storage space and a beautiful design element in your home. Whether you’re working with built-in shelves, a freestanding bookcase, or floating wall shelves, the right styling can elevate your space while keeping it organized. With a mix of books, decorative objects, and personal touches, you can create a bookshelf display that feels curated and effortlessly chic.

Start with a Balanced Layout

The key to a chic bookshelf is balance. Instead of filling every shelf with books, mix in decorative accents, artwork, or plants to create visual interest. Varying the height and placement of items prevents the display from looking too uniform while keeping it visually appealing. A mix of vertical and horizontal book stacks can help create a dynamic yet polished arrangement.



Incorporate a Neutral or Coordinated Color Palette

A cohesive color palette makes a bookshelf feel intentional and put-together. If your book collection is colorful, consider arranging books by tone for a visually harmonious look. If you prefer a more neutral aesthetic, use book covers in muted tones, or turn books with vibrant spines inward for a softer appearance. Layering in decorative objects in similar hues helps tie everything together.



Mix in Decorative Objects and Textures

Bookshelves should hold more than just books. Incorporating a variety of textures with ceramic vases, woven baskets, sculptural pieces, and framed prints adds depth and interest. Glass or metallic accents bring a touch of elegance, while natural materials like wood and stone add warmth and character.



Add Personal Touches

Personal items like framed photos, travel souvenirs, or heirloom pieces make a bookshelf feel unique and reflective of your personality. Mixing in meaningful objects ensures that the display doesn’t feel overly staged or impersonal. Layering in small photo frames or placing a decorative box on a stack of books creates a lived-in, curated effect.



Use Greenery for a Fresh and Lively Look

Plants bring a bookshelf to life, adding movement and a natural element to the display. Small potted plants, trailing vines, or dried flowers can soften the overall look and create a more inviting feel. Choosing low-maintenance plants like pothos or succulents ensures your greenery stays fresh without requiring constant upkeep.
